Fresh off a glamorous European red carpet appearance with girlfriend Kylie Jenner, Timothée Chalamet is back on his home turf—and proving he’s just as comfortable courtside as he is on the Cannes carpet.
The Dune actor was recently spotted front and center at Madison Square Garden, where he watched his hometown team, the New York Knicks, battle the Boston Celtics. While the Knicks didn’t snag the win, Chalamet’s courtside look was undeniably a slam dunk.
A Love Letter to NYC—In Full Knicks Blue
The actor repped his city hard in a bold, fully coordinated ensemble: an oversized blue Knicks-branded sports jacket paired with matching striped pants. Capping off the electric-blue outfit? A matching blue cap that drove home his Knicks loyalty.
The look wasn’t just spirited—it was polished and fashion-forward, thanks to one key detail: a pair of Rick Owens high-top sneakers. True to the brand’s edgy aesthetic, Chalamet wrapped the laces around his ankles for a subtly rebellious twist.
Back From Rome, Still Making Headlines
Chalamet’s courtside sighting comes just days after his highly buzzed-about debut on the red carpet with Jenner at the 70th David di Donatello Awards in Rome. The couple turned heads at the prestigious Italian film ceremony, where Chalamet was honored with the David Award for Cinematic Excellence.
Jenner matched the occasion’s elegance in a plunging black Schiaparelli gown, while Chalamet looked sharp in a sleek velvet suit. Their hand-in-hand arrival officially marked a new era in their public relationship.
